Networking and Surveillance

Networking and surveillance include equipment for operation, security, and stable data communication across environments requiring performance and reliability. The category covers routers, switches, wireless solutions, PoE equipment, as well as cameras and accessories for surveillance. The focus is on scalable solutions that can be implemented in everything from small installations to advanced network environments.

Benefits for Resellers

A broad selection of networking and surveillance products makes it possible to assemble complete solutions with high operational stability. Access to both entry-level and advanced products provides flexibility in projects and makes it easy to match different performance requirements. The combination of routers, switches, PoE solutions, and surveillance equipment simplifies procurement, standardisation, and maintenance planning.

Key Considerations in This Category

  • Bandwidth, throughput, and stability when selecting routers and switches.
  • Security levels, firewall capacity, and segmentation.
  • Coverage, signal strength, and load within wireless environments.
  • Power delivery via PoE and compatibility across devices.
  • Surveillance capabilities, resolution, and storage options.

Frequently Asked Questions

How is capacity determined when selecting routers and switches?

Capacity is based on the number of connected devices, desired throughput, and PoE requirements to ensure the network handles both current and future load.

When is controller-based network management most relevant?

Controller-based solutions are recommended when multiple access points and switches need central management with unified security policies and scalable control.

What factors matter most for stable operation in surveillance environments?

Resolution, light sensitivity, storage capacity, and correct camera placement determine reliability, documentation quality, and overall system stability.
